woodenshoes wrote:
- dex-cool is ok for old volvo's (returning today)

Please DO NOT use Dex Cool. This product DOES cause gasket failure in nylon based gaskets. I have 2 vehicles where this is the factory fill (GM products) and both had or have continuing coolant leak problems until I replaced the coolant with the "green" stuff
